BJP’s 33-year journey has been that of creating a new ray of hope among the people of India: Narendra Modi

On the evening of Saturday 6th April 2013 the BJP held a massive Karyakarta Mahasammelan in Ahmedabad to mark the 33rd Sthapana Diwas of the Party. BJP President Shri Rajnath Singh attended the Mahasammelan and was felicitated on the taking over as the National President. Also felicitated were newly appointed Vice President Smt. Smriti Irani and General Secretary Shri Amit Shah. Addressing a packed gathering, Shri Narendra Modi affirmed that the BJP was not born out of the lure of power or for brokers of power but the party was born for the well being of each and every citizen. He pointed out that the BJP’s 33-year journey has been that of creating a new ray of hope among the people of India.
He stated that wherever the BJP has reached is not due to any one person but generations of Karyakartas and their families. Shri Modi affirmed that for the BJP, the ‘Desh’ is above the ‘Dal’ (Above the party is the nation). “We will work anywhere for Bharat Mata. Our Mantra here is Gujarat’s growth for India’s growth. I said it on my first day and I am saying it now- will leave no stone unturned in working hard.”
Shri Modi said, “There is a big difference between the BJP and the Congress. There cannot be a comparison.” Taking on the Centre for the rampant misuse of power Shri Modi affirmed, “I want to warn those sitting in Delhi- if you think your CBI attacks will make us unhappy you are wrong. If you think you can trouble BJP Governments with Governors then take it in writing…the people will give you an answer and have already answered you.”
Talking about the patriotic zeal of BJP workers, Shri Modi stated, “When one does good, there are many obstacles. What is the reason that in states like Kerala and West Bengal so many BJP workers lose their lives, at the hands of Left cadres, for the sake of the country? In spite of this and despite the fact that they are nowhere close to power our Karyakartas continue to work”
Shri Modi took a dig at the top Congress leadership for their poor understanding of India. He declared, “I heard a speech of the Congress leader and I was pained. I wondered if they think like this for the nation! The Congress leader said India is a beehive. For you it may be a beehive but for us, this nation is our Mother. Bharat is our Mata and its people are our brothers and sisters. This is a pure land and a land of saints, Rishis.” He added, “Do not insult our Bharat Mata. If you do not understand India go learn but do not do this.”
Taking on the Congress leaders, both in Gujarat and in Delhi Shri Modi said, “There is a big water shortage but their leaders are not even aware of it.” He affirmed that the Gujarat Congress leaders are misleading the people in the name of water and further pointed, “I tell them, if you are worried about the farmers, tell your Government in the Centre give permission to raise the height of the Sardar Sarovar Dam. We cannot wait any longer to finish work on the Sardar Sarovar Dam. Congress will have to give an answer to the people.”
imilarly, the Chief Minister shared that the people of Gujarat have taught the Congress a lesson in the Elections, defeated their leaders and given a fitting answer to the sort of language they used yet, they have not changed. “We thought they will change, follow democratic ideals but only now we are completing 100 days and they were not willing to wait even for so long.”
Thanking Shri Rajnath Singh for his very kind words earlier during the programme, Shri Modi said, “You (Rajnath Singh ji) have been very kind to me. The name may be taken of Modi but the credit goes to my Karyakartas brothers and sisters. If they had not worked hard, who would know Narendra Modi? This is all due to them.”
